Citi extends securities lending services to Malaysia

Citi now offers securities lending services in Malaysia through its OpenLend platform. The new service will allow offshore and domestic investors access to the Malaysian market.

The firm’s current expansion follows a string of recent launches including securities lending on the National Stock Exchange in India and an industry trading desk in Dublin.

David Russell, Asia Pacific head of securities and fund services at Citi, said: “The launch of the securities lending services in Malaysia further underscores our commitment to expanding our product offering.”

“The new service leverages our deep on-the-ground expertise and global capabilities through our core in-country infrastructure, as well as our product and relationship teams.”

David Martocci, global head of securities finance for Citi transaction services, said: “Emerging markets are an area of particular expertise for our business as we are able to leverage Citi’s vast global footprint and our team’s deep market knowledge.”

“Extending our lending services in Asia enables our clients to take advantage of the lucrative revenue opportunities in these markets such as Malaysia.”
